Description

This end terrace house is situated on a quiet residential street in Helmond West, characterized by predominantly continuous building development. The property benefits from free parking in the immediate vicinity, which is a practical advantage for residents. The home is located within walking distance of the Helmond city center, as well as a shopping center offering various retail facilities, making daily errands convenient.

The ground floor of the property features a hall and entrance area that provides access to the meter cupboard, a toilet room, and the staircase leading to the upper floors. From the entrance, one enters the living room, which is oriented towards the rear garden. This living space is notably bright due to its positioning and the presence of large windows. The floor is finished with vinyl throughout, providing a uniform and practical surface. A central staircase cupboard offers additional storage space on this level.

The kitchen is accessible from the living room and is arranged in a wall configuration. It includes a selection of upper and lower cabinets, a synthetic worktop, a gas hob, an extractor hood, and a tiled backsplash. A large window in the kitchen allows for pleasant natural light and offers a view of the street at the front of the property.

The first floor is accessible via a fixed staircase and features a landing that gives access to two bedrooms and the bathroom. The first bedroom measures approximately 2.40 by 2.60 meters, making it suitable as a smaller bedroom, children's room, or home office. The second bedroom is significantly larger, measuring approximately 4.65 by 3.90 meters, and serves as the main bedroom. Notably, this main bedroom is equipped with air conditioning, providing comfort during warmer months. The layout of this large bedroom is such that it can be relatively easily divided into two separate bedrooms, which would increase the total number of sleeping quarters to four.

The bathroom is located at the front of the first floor and is finished in light tones, contributing to a fresh and spacious feel. It is equipped with a fixed washbasin with a shelf and cabinet, a shower cabin, and connections for both a second toilet and a bathtub. This setup offers flexibility for future modifications should the new owners wish to add these facilities.

The second floor is reached via a fixed staircase and offers a spacious area that currently serves as a third bedroom. This floor also provides ample storage options. The CV combination boiler, which is rented rather than owned, is installed on this level. Additionally, the connections for laundry appliances are located here, making this floor practical for utility purposes alongside its function as a bedroom.

It is worth noting that the second floor, measuring 19 square meters, is not included in the total living area of 81 square meters. This is because the glass surface of the skylight is smaller than 0.5 square meters, which means this space is classified as other indoor space according to measurement standards. By installing a larger skylight, this area could potentially be recognized as living space, which would increase the official living area to 100 square meters.

The rear garden is oriented to the southwest, which is a favorable position for sunlight throughout the afternoon and evening. The garden includes a sun terrace, a freestanding stone storage shed, and a private back entrance. The boundaries of the garden are defined by wooden fence panels, providing privacy. The garden has a depth of 8.00 meters and a width of 5.50 meters, totaling 44 square meters.

The property was built in 1998 and features a gabled roof covered with tiles. It has a B energy label, which indicates a reasonable level of energy efficiency. The insulation includes roof insulation, double glazing, wall insulation, and floor insulation, with the property being fully insulated. Heating and hot water are provided by a gas-fired CV combination boiler from the brand Intergas, which was installed in 2019 and is rented.

Additional features of the property include mechanical ventilation, natural ventilation options, and a TV cable connection. The total content of the house is 356 cubic meters. The property is offered with a transfer date to be agreed upon.

The cadastral designation is Helmond G 3093, with a plot area of 97 square meters. The property is held in full ownership. The asking price at the time of listing was 325,000 euros, costs to be borne by the buyer, which equates to approximately 4,012 euros per square meter of living space. The listing indicates that the property has been sold subject to contract at the time of this evaluation.
